Mat Kearney released his second studio album titled Nothing Left to Lose on April 18, 2006 on Columbia Records. The album came out to be a huge commercial and critical success and sold over 450,000 copies to date. The title track from the album was released as the first single from the album, and it also managed to sell 500,000 copies. The single also earned numerous awards including BMI Awards. All I Need was another single from the album that did considerably well, and was featured in hit TV series Grey’s Anatomy. It also charted on iTunes top 100 downloaded songs. Following the release of his second album, Kearney went on tour with the artists like Sheryl Crow, John Mayer, Train, Cary Brothers and MUTEMATH to help promote his album. In 2007, he also performed as a headlining act at the You Oughta Know Tour. On May 19, 2009 Kearney came up with his follow up studio release titled City of Black & White. The album was also released by Columbia Records and featured other artists like Will Sayles, Josiah Bell, Paul Moak and Daniel James. Close to Love and All I Have were released as first two singles from the album. The album peaked and debuted at #13 spot on Billboard 200 Chart. Later on Kearney went on a tour with The Hello Sequence and Keane to support his album. Kearney released his most recent studio work on August 2, 2011 by the name of Young Love. Prior to the release of the album, Kearney released Hey Mama as the first single from the album and it peaked at #22 spot on Adult Pop Songs. Down was released as the follow up single of the album. Over the years, Kearney’s work has been featured in a number of hit TV series as well. His songs have been a soundtrack for the shows like Grey’s Anatomy, What About Brian, 30 Rock, Friday Night Lights, The Closer, NCIS, Wildfire and Without A Trace. Mat Kearney Announces CrazyTalk Tour
American singer and songwriter Mat Kearney recently announced a North American tour in support of its upcoming music album Crazytalk. The trek includes stops in a total of 33 cities, with the first show scheduled to take place in Spokane on February 19. It will then visit main cities including Nashville, Dallas, Los Angeles, Seattle, New York and Philadelphia. Joining him on tour as special guest will be Andrew Belle.
Crazytalk is Kearney’s sixth studio record. It is slated to release via Caroline Records in early 2018.
